Step 1: Locate the Control Panel
The first step in setting the time on your Oster microwave is to locate the control panel. This is the area on the front of the microwave where all the buttons are located. Take a moment to familiarize yourself with the panel and make sure you can easily access it.
Step 2: Turn on the Microwave
Now that you know where the control panel is, it’s time to turn on the microwave. Locate the power button on the panel and press it to switch on the appliance.
Step 3: Access the Time Setting Function
Once the microwave is powered on, you’ll need to access the time setting function. Look for a button on the control panel that is labeled “Time” or “Clock.” Press this button to enter the time setting mode.
Step 4: Set the Hours
After you’ve entered the time setting mode, your microwave’s display should be flashing or blinking. This indicates that you’re now able to set the hours. Look for buttons on the control panel that are labeled with numbers. Press the appropriate buttons to enter the current hour.
Step 5: Set the Minutes
Once you’ve set the hours, it’s time to move on to setting the minutes. Similar to the previous step, look for buttons on the control panel that are labeled with numbers. Press the appropriate buttons to enter the current minute.
Step 6: Finalize the Time Setting
After you’ve set the hours and minutes, you’ll need to finalize the time setting. Look for a button on the control panel that is labeled “OK” or “Set.” Press this button to confirm the time you’ve entered.
Step 7: Verify the Time
Once you’ve completed all the previous steps, take a moment to verify that you’ve set the time correctly. Look at the display on the microwave and make sure it reflects the current time.
Troubleshooting Tips
If you encounter any difficulties while setting the time on your Oster microwave, here are a few troubleshooting tips to help you out:
– Refer to the user manual
If you’re unsure about any step in the process, consult the user manual that came with your Oster microwave. It usually contains detailed instructions specific to your model.
– Power cycle the microwave
If you’re still having trouble, try turning off the microwave completely and unplugging it from the power source. Wait for a few minutes and then plug it back in. This can sometimes resolve any software glitches that may be interfering with the time setting.
– Contact customer support
If all else fails, don’t hesitate to reach out to customer support for assistance. They can walk you through the process and help troubleshoot any issues you may be experiencing.
